Overview of Position

This is a critical role to ensure that schools can open safely and that all health and safety protocols are followed with regard to COVID-19.

Responsible providing overall support for COVID-19 operations in the school setting. Will greet caregivers and students with a warm and friendly tone upon arrival to the school. Document status of attestation; assist students and parents to obtain accurate health screening information. Must be flexible and willing to work at assigned school location where needed.

Hours to be determined by school leader.

Essential Functions

20%

  • Greet students/caregivers who did not complete the attestation remotely and assist with kiosk attestation process or if caregivers not present, follow up by phone to determine student attestation status.
15%
  • Escort students to and supervise the protective healthcare room as needed; if students are present, call families to coordinate pick up.
10%
  • Serve as the designee for the COVID Site Supervisor when building leaders are not present.
10%
  • Cover breaks and lunches for educators, when possible.
10%
  • Supervise students as needed (playground, dismissal, transitions).
10%
  • Check periodically to ensure health and safety supplies such as wipes, hand sanitizers, etc. and work with COVID site supervisor to replenish.
10%
  • Assist office staff with printing and distribution of electronic attestation rosters to educators prior to student arrival.
5%
  • Coordinate with educators a plan for sending students who arrive on campus and either did not complete or did not pass the daily attestation to the Health & Safety Support staff person.
5%
  • Keep records manually or electronically tracking attestations, supplies, as needed.
5%
  • Other duties that may arise related to in-person learning to support staff and administrators.
